How much do remote apprentice interior designer j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 12,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ote apprentice interior designer in the United States is $72,849.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$58,000.00 and $83,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Remote Apprentice Interior Designer vs Remote Junior Interior Designer?

AspectRemote Apprentice Interior DesignerRemote Junior Interior Designer
Required CredentialsBasic education, some design coursesAssociate's or Bachelor's in Interior Design, certification preferred
Work EnvironmentMentorship, training-focused, entry-level tasksProject assistance, client communication, design development
Employer UsageInternship programs, training firmsDesign firms, architecture companies

The main difference is that a Remote Apprentice Interior Designer is typically in training or learning phase, focusing on gaining skills under supervision, while a Remote Junior Interior Designer has more experience and handles more independent tasks within design projects.
